• Lille Cathedral is a Roman Catholic church and basilica located in Lille, France. It is the cathedral church of the Archdiocese of Lille.
  • Lille Cathedral is a cathedral that was begun in 1854. The project is located in Lille, Nord (59), Hauts-de-France, France.
